技术文摘
如何操作 MySQL 登录远程数据库
如何操作 MySQL 登录远程数据库
在日常的数据库管理与开发工作中,登录远程 MySQL 数据库是一项常见需求。下面将详细介绍操作步骤,帮助你顺利实现登录。
要确保远程数据库服务器已正确配置并允许远程连接。这需要在 MySQL 配置文件(通常是 my.cnf 或 my.ini)中进行设置。找到并修改绑定地址(bind-address)选项,将其设置为 0.0.0.0 或者注释掉这一行,以允许来自任何 IP 地址的连接。要检查防火墙设置,开放 MySQL 所使用的端口,默认是 3306,确保外部连接能够顺利通过。
接下来创建用于远程登录的用户账号。登录到本地 MySQL 数据库,使用具有足够权限的账号。通过 SQL 语句创建新用户并分配权限。例如:“CREATE USER 'username'@'%' IDENTIFIED BY 'password';”,这里的“username”是你自定义的用户名,“%”表示允许从任何主机连接,“password”则是该用户的密码。之后,使用“GRANT ALL PRIVILEGES ON database_name.* TO 'username'@'%';”语句授予该用户对指定数据库(database_name)的所有权限。执行“FLUSH PRIVILEGES;”使权限设置生效。
在本地,你需要安装并配置 MySQL 客户端工具。常见的有 MySQL Workbench、Navicat 等。以 MySQL Workbench 为例,打开软件后,点击“File”,选择“New Connection”。在弹出的窗口中,输入远程数据库服务器的主机名或 IP 地址,填写刚才创建的用户名和密码。端口号保持默认的 3306 即可。可以点击“Test Connection”按钮测试连接是否成功。若出现连接失败提示,仔细检查上述配置步骤是否正确。
使用命令行登录远程数据库也是一种常用方式。打开命令提示符,输入“mysql -h remote_host -u username -p”,其中“remote_host”是远程数据库服务器的地址,“username”是登录用户名。回车后输入密码,若配置无误,就能成功登录到远程 MySQL 数据库。
掌握这些操作方法,无论你是开发人员还是数据库管理员,都能轻松登录远程 MySQL 数据库,高效开展工作。
- Flask中url_for()生成包含端口号URL的方法
- 利用IP定位服务获取访问者区域信息及提取相关数据的方法
- Golang HTTP服务中ResponseWriter发送数据延迟原因探究
- Hyperf重启时AMQP异常的警告信息处理方法
- MySQL中存储和读取PHP代码的方法
- PHP中安全存储PHP代码、HTML代码及字符串的方法
- PHP 中如何安全地将代码与字符串存储至数据库
- Golang 中 HTTP 响应延迟:CPU 密集操作致响应发送延迟的原因
- 怎样依据 IP 地址判定访问者区域并提取相关信息
- Go正则表达式成对匹配并替换方括号内文本的方法
- Pandas库合并CSV文件中同一列重复内容的方法
- Python 异常处理无 except 报错:列表出现重复元素的原因
- PHP多维数组中获取指定键名同级前一个数组内容的方法
- PHP json_encode()编码中文乱码问题的解决方法
- Golang中用自定义结构体替代echo.HTTPError会遇哪些问题